Comparison of PNY RTX A2000 video card vs PNY RTX A2000 12GB video card by specifications and benchmarks. PNY RTX A2000 runs at 0.562 GHz base clock speed and has 6 GB of GDDR6 memory, while video card PNY RTX A2000 12GB runs at 0.562 GHz base clock speed and has 12 GB of GDDR6 memory. The TDP of the first video card is 70 W, and the second is 70 W. Compare the table of benchmark results to find out which graphic card is better.

Memory

The values comparison for the amount, type and speed of memory, along with the bandwidth in the PNY RTX A2000 and PNY RTX A2000 12GB GPUs. A sufficiently large amount of graphics memory with high frequency and adequate bandwidth positively affects the speed of high resolution texture processing.

  • Memory Size
    6 GB left arrow 12 GB
  • Memory Type
    GDDR6 left arrow GDDR6
  • Memory Clock
    1.500 GHz left arrow 1.500 GHz
  • Memory Speed
    0 Gbps left arrow 0 Gbps
  • Memory Bandwith
    288 GB/s left arrow 288 GB/s
  • Memory Interface
    192 bit left arrow 192 bit

Cooler & Fans

Here we are going to look at the types of cooling systems for PNY RTX A2000 and PNY RTX A2000 12GB as well as their sizes and performance. As a rule, fans with larger diameters have an advantage because they can move the same volumes of air while rotating more slowly than smaller fans. It should be noted that liquid cooling systems in addition to fans and aluminum radiators need some kind of pump, which can also be noisy.

  • Fan-Type
    Radial left arrow Radial
  • Fan 1
    1 x 40 mm left arrow 1 x 65 mm
  • Cooler-Type
    Air cooling left arrow Air cooling
